She started out as a small town Texas girl, became a stripper, married an octogenarian, buried him, became the 1993 Playboy Playmate of the Year, went to the Supreme Court to fight for her husband's estate, filmed a reality show, lost a ton of weight, had a new baby, buried her son, "married" her lawyer in a non-legal ceremony, endured a nasty paternity fight regarding the baby, and was just sued YESTERDAY for her role in TrimSpa's misrepresentation of its products.
